Output 29f1618357717eade1f8283486bf397ea0a3e266252e001c88ba634cfaf1de4a:0

value
31772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c2d376c4e12d846fe402cb78bc31fbc997a06e1 OP_EQUAL
address
38doSpX6x11B2uUvygXWTU3s1frgXcRKe5
transaction
29f1618357717eade1f8283486bf397ea0a3e266252e001c88ba634cfaf1de4a
spent
true